Don’t leave home without:

Most properties do not supply linen, so do not forget to pack the following:

Sheets

Pillowcases

Bath towels

Tea towels

Dishcloth

Other little items to pack which may or may not be supplied:

Toilet paper

Soap

Dishwashing liquid

Bug spray

If you do forget any of the above, DON’T PANIC!

  1. You can hire linen from the Tea Gardens Laundry Service, your estate agent will have contact details.
  2. There is a huge chemist on the corner of Yamba St and Tuloa Avenue.
  3. The IGA supermarket is in Booner St.

Desirable areas to stay:

Anything close to Jimmy’s Beach as again, this is the area for rigging, launching and racing.

The Boulevarde – across the road to Jimmy’s Beach. Only area for water views over the harbour.

Coorilla St - opposite Jimmy’s Beach.

Beach Rd – opposite the surf beach.

The block between Jimmy’s Beach and the Golf Club.

Eating Out: Call and book at the restaurants in Tea Gardens, even just to check if they are open. Go early, often last orders are at 9pm.

CASUAL DINING There are a few cafes in Hawks Nest, mostly on Booner St and in Tea Gardens on Marine Parade.

The local Golf Club is a safe bet for a table for lunch or dinner, no breakfast, but book for large groups. (02 4997 0145).

FINE DINING Depending on your definition of fine dining, save this for the city.
